Sally Acorn is a prominent character in the Sonic the Hedgehog universe, known for her intelligence, resourcefulness, and strong personality. She's far more than just a damsel in distress; she's a skilled fighter, a strategic leader, and a vital part of the ongoing struggle against Dr. Robotnik (or Eggman). Understanding Sally requires looking at her character arc, her abilities, and her significance within the larger Sonic narrative.

Is Sally Acorn a princess?

Yes, Sally Acorn is a princess. She is the princess of Mobius and the rightful heir to the throne. This royal lineage adds another layer to her character, giving her a sense of responsibility and duty beyond her personal battles against Dr. Robotnik. Her regal background often plays a part in the storylines, influencing her decisions and actions.

What are Sally Acorn's powers and abilities?

While not possessing the super-speed of Sonic or the raw strength of Knuckles, Sally's strength lies in her intellect and strategic thinking. She's a highly skilled fighter, often utilizing gadgets and technology developed in her workshop. Her abilities include:

  • Expert Strategist: Sally consistently displays remarkable tactical prowess, devising plans to outsmart Robotnik and his forces.
  • Skilled Mechanic and Inventor: She designs and builds various technological devices, from communication tools to weapons and vehicles, showcasing her engineering skills.
  • Martial Arts Proficiency: While not a master like Knuckles, Sally is adept at hand-to-hand combat, frequently using her agility and fighting skills in battle.
  • Leadership Skills: Sally often leads teams, inspiring and guiding her allies in their fight against evil. She's shown herself to be a capable and courageous leader.

What is Sally Acorn's role in the Sonic comics and games?

Sally's role has varied across different iterations of the Sonic franchise. She's played a much larger part in the Archie Comics series than in the video games. In the comics, she is a central character, leading the Freedom Fighters against Dr. Robotnik and frequently working alongside Sonic and other allies. Her presence in the games is more sporadic, but she still holds a significant place within the larger Sonic lore.

What is Sally Acorn's personality like?

Sally is portrayed as intelligent, brave, resourceful, and determined. She is not afraid to take charge, often acting as the strategist and leader for the Freedom Fighters. However, she also shows moments of vulnerability and compassion, demonstrating a caring and empathetic side. Her personality is a complex mix of strength and empathy, making her a compelling character.

Why is Sally Acorn less prominent in recent Sonic games?

The reduced presence of Sally Acorn in modern Sonic games is a topic of much discussion among fans. Several factors might contribute to this:

  • Shifting Focus: The overall direction and tone of the Sonic games have evolved over time, leading to a focus on different characters and storylines.
  • Franchise Reboots: Reboots and reimaginings often involve changes to established characters and their roles within the narrative.
  • Game Design Choices: Gameplay mechanics and narrative structures may not always accommodate the specific character dynamics involving Sally and the Freedom Fighters.

While she's less prominent, Sally remains a beloved character whose impact on the Sonic franchise is undeniable. Her legacy and influence continue to resonate with fans, even in her reduced presence in modern games.
